//source: http://stackoverflow.com/questions/17722497/scroll-smoothly-to-specific-element-on-page | |
function currentYPosition() { | |
// Firefox, Chrome, Opera, Safari | |
if (self.pageYOffset) return self.pageYOffset; | |
// Internet Explorer 6 - standards mode | |
if (document.documentElement && document.documentElement.scrollTop) | |
return document.documentElement.scrollTop; | |
// Internet Explorer 6, 7 and 8 | |
if (document.body.scrollTop) return document.body.scrollTop; | |
return 0; | |
} | |
function elmYPosition(eID) { | |
let elm = document.getElementById(eID); | |
if (elm === null) { | |
console.warn('#dfd4s cant smooth scroll to non existing element id: ' + eID) | |
} else { | |
let y = elm.offsetTop; | |
let node = elm; | |
while (node.offsetParent && node.offsetParent != document.body) { | |
node = node.offsetParent; | |
y += node.offsetTop; | |
} | |
return y; | |
} | |
} | |
export const ElementInViewport = ({eID}) => { | |
let el = document.getElementById(eID); | |
let top = el.offsetTop; | |
let left = el.offsetLeft; | |
const width = el.offsetWidth; | |
const height = el.offsetHeight; | |
while (el.offsetParent) { | |
el = el.offsetParent; | |
top += el.offsetTop; | |
left += el.offsetLeft; | |
} | |
return ( | |
top < (window.pageYOffset + window.innerHeight) && | |
left < (window.pageXOffset + window.innerWidth) && | |
(top + height) > window.pageYOffset && | |
(left + width) > window.pageXOffset | |
); | |
} | |
export const SmoothScroll = ({eID, padding = 0}) => { | |
let startY = currentYPosition(); | |
let stopY = elmYPosition(eID); | |
stopY += padding; | |
let distance = stopY > startY ? stopY - startY : startY - stopY; | |
if (distance < 100) { | |
scrollTo(0, stopY); | |
return; | |
} | |
let speed = Math.round(distance / 100); | |
if (speed >= 20) speed = 20; | |
let step = Math.round(distance / 25); | |
let leapY = stopY > startY ? startY + step : startY - step; | |
let timer = 0; | |
if (stopY > startY) { | |
for (let i = startY; i < stopY; i += step) { | |
setTimeout("window.scrollTo(0, " + leapY + ")", timer * speed); | |
leapY += step; | |
if (leapY > stopY) leapY = stopY; | |
timer++; | |
} | |
return; | |
} | |
for (let i = startY; i > stopY; i -= step) { | |
setTimeout("window.scrollTo(0, " + leapY + ")", timer * speed); | |
leapY -= step; | |
if (leapY < stopY) leapY = stopY; | |
timer++; | |
} | |
return false; | |
} |
